Solution

The correct option is B

homeostasis


Homeostasis can be defined as a property of an organism or system that maintains its parameters, like temperature, blood pressure, water content, salt content etc. within a constant range.
An endotherm is an organism that maintains its body at a metabolically favorable temperature, largely by the use of heat released by its internal bodily functions instead of relying on ambient heat.
Exotherm or a cold-blooded animal unlike an endotherm cannot regulate its body temperature and the internal temperature varies along with the ambient temperature. A stenotherm is a species or living organism capable of living or surviving only within a narrow temperature range.
